".$data[0][name]."
"; } function event_data($niid){ // $items[] = l(''.$niid , 'node/'. $niid,''); // print theme('node_list', $items, ''); // unset($items); $qr="select * from event where nid=".$niid; $rs =mysql_query($qr); $trow=mysql_num_rows($rs); $data =mysql_fetch_array($rs); return $data; } function node_data($niid){ // unset($items); $qr="select * from node where nid=".$niid; $rs =mysql_query($qr); $trow=mysql_num_rows($rs); $data =mysql_fetch_array($rs); return $data; //return "body".$niid; } function node_bod($niid){ // unset($items); $qr="select * from node_revisions where nid=".$niid; $rs =mysql_query($qr); $trow=mysql_num_rows($rs); $data =mysql_fetch_array($rs); return $data; //return "body".$niid; } function node_extra($niid){ // unset($items); $qr="select * from content_type_event where nid=".$niid; $rs =mysql_query($qr); $trow=mysql_num_rows($rs); $data =mysql_fetch_array($rs); return $data; //return "body".$niid; } //print event using nid function print_events($eventarr){ foreach($eventarr as $niid){ $eve_data=event_data($niid); $node_data=node_data($niid); $node_bod=node_bod($niid); $node_extra=node_extra($niid); $eventdata.="
"; if($eve_data[event_end]) $eventdata.="End: ".date('l, j/m/Y h:i:s A',$eve_data[event_end])."
"; $eventdata.="
"; $eventdata.="Fees: ".$node_extra[field_fees_value]."
"; $eventdata.="Location: ".$node_extra[field_location_value]."
"; $eventdata.="Phone: ".$node_extra[field_phone_value]."
"; $eventdata.="Email Address: ".$node_extra[field_address_0_format]."
"; } return $eventdata; } //get event of user function get_events_by_uid($usrdata){ $nidarr=array(); foreach($usrdata as $uid){ $qr="select nid from node where type='event' and uid=".$uid; $rs =mysql_query($qr); $trow=mysql_num_rows($rs); if($trow>0){ while($dg=mysql_fetch_array($rs)) $nidarr[]=$dg[nid]; } } return $nidarr; } // get id by GET methode $stateid=$_GET[stateid]; if(chk_state($stateid)){ /////main if //print flag nad state name print getFlag($stateid); //15 is the adjustment factor careful $fiid=15+$stateid; $qry="SELECT uid FROM `profile_values` where fid=".$fiid." and value=1 order by uid"; $rs=mysql_query($qry); $num=mysql_num_rows($rs); if($num>0){ //start if 00 while($dt=mysql_fetch_array($rs)) $usrdata[]=$dt['uid']; //call the event listing of created by each user $event_nid_arry= get_events_by_uid($usrdata); // print "This is final array of events belongs to state id: ".$stateid.'
'; // print "
"; } function event_data($niid){ // $items[] = l(''.$niid , 'node/'. $niid,''); // print theme('node_list', $items, ''); // unset($items); $qr="select * from event where nid=".$niid; $rs =mysql_query($qr); $trow=mysql_num_rows($rs); $data =mysql_fetch_array($rs); return $data; } function node_data($niid){ // unset($items); $qr="select * from node where nid=".$niid; $rs =mysql_query($qr); $trow=mysql_num_rows($rs); $data =mysql_fetch_array($rs); return $data; //return "body".$niid; } function node_bod($niid){ // unset($items); $qr="select * from node_revisions where nid=".$niid; $rs =mysql_query($qr); $trow=mysql_num_rows($rs); $data =mysql_fetch_array($rs); return $data; //return "body".$niid; } function node_extra($niid){ // unset($items); $qr="select * from content_type_event where nid=".$niid; $rs =mysql_query($qr); $trow=mysql_num_rows($rs); $data =mysql_fetch_array($rs); return $data; //return "body".$niid; } //print event using nid function print_events($eventarr){ foreach($eventarr as $niid){ $eve_data=event_data($niid); $node_data=node_data($niid); $node_bod=node_bod($niid); $node_extra=node_extra($niid); $eventdata.="
"; $eventdata.="".$node_data['title'].""; $eventdata.="
"; if($eve_data[event_start]) $eventdata.="Start: ".date('l, j/m/Y h:i:s A',$eve_data[event_start]).""; if($eve_data[event_end]) $eventdata.="End: ".date('l, j/m/Y h:i:s A',$eve_data[event_end])."
"; $eventdata.="
".$node_bod[body]."
"; $eventdata.="Contact Name: ".$node_extra[field_conatct_name_value].""; $eventdata.="Fees: ".$node_extra[field_fees_value]."
"; $eventdata.="Location: ".$node_extra[field_location_value]."
"; $eventdata.="Phone: ".$node_extra[field_phone_value]."
"; $eventdata.="Email Address: ".$node_extra[field_address_0_format]."
"; } return $eventdata; } //get event of user function get_events_by_uid($usrdata){ $nidarr=array(); foreach($usrdata as $uid){ $qr="select nid from node where type='event' and uid=".$uid; $rs =mysql_query($qr); $trow=mysql_num_rows($rs); if($trow>0){ while($dg=mysql_fetch_array($rs)) $nidarr[]=$dg[nid]; } } return $nidarr; } // get id by GET methode $stateid=$_GET[stateid]; if(chk_state($stateid)){ /////main if //print flag nad state name print getFlag($stateid); //15 is the adjustment factor careful $fiid=15+$stateid; $qry="SELECT uid FROM `profile_values` where fid=".$fiid." and value=1 order by uid"; $rs=mysql_query($qry); $num=mysql_num_rows($rs); if($num>0){ //start if 00 while($dt=mysql_fetch_array($rs)) $usrdata[]=$dt['uid']; //call the event listing of created by each user $event_nid_arry= get_events_by_uid($usrdata); // print "This is final array of events belongs to state id: ".$stateid.'
'; // print "
"; print print_events($event_nid_arry); // print ""; } else{ print "No records found..."; } ///end if 00 } else{ ///// else of mail if print "Invalid State Id..."; } ?>